본문 바로가기

git8

[Linux] wget 명령어 사용 불가 현상 해결 방법(Window) - "command not found" [Trouble] Window에서는 리눅스 명령어인 wget를 사용할 수 없다. [Solution] 지금 우리는 윈도우 운영체제에서 리눅스를 사용하고 있기 때문에 리눅스 명령어인 wget이 지원되지 않는다. 따라서 윈도우용 wget 실행 파일을 다운받아야 한다. 1. 아래 사이트에서 운영체제에 맞는 버전을 다운 윈도우용 wget 실행 파일 GNU Wget 1.21.4 for Windows eternallybored.org 2. Windows의 System32 폴더에 넣어준다. 3. 환경변수에 wget.exe 파일의 경로를 추가해준다. 정상적으로 다운로드되었다면, HTTP request sent, awaiting response... 200 OK 메세지가 출력된다. [Result] 이제 wget명령어를 사.. 2023. 10. 17.
[Linux] Git Bash 한글 깨짐 현상 해결 방법(Window) [Trouble] Git Bash 사용 시, 한글 깨짐 현상 발생 [Solution] 1. 아래 경로의 bash.bashrc 파일을 열어준다. C:\Program Files\Git\etc\bash.bashrc 2. 맨 아랫줄에 아래 코드 추가 export LC_ALL='ko_KR.UTF-8' export LANG='ko_KR.UTF-8' 3. Git Bash를 실행하고 locale 입력 아래 그림처럼 출력된다면, 정상적으로 잘 적용된 것이다. 4. 그래도 안 된다면? ① Git Bash의 콘솔 창을 우클릭해서 옵션으로 들어간다. ② Locale을 ko_KR, Character Set을 eucKR로 설정해주면 완료. [Result] 한글이 정상적으로 잘 출력된다. 2023. 10. 17.
GitHub 사용법 5편 : Git에서의 작업을 되돌리는 명령어(Reset, Revert) [개요] Git system Git은 일반적으로 세 가지 트리를 관리하는 시스템이며, 여기서 트리는 '파일의 묶음'이라 생각하면 된다. 1. Working Directory : 현재 작업 중인 코드와 파일들이 실제로 존재하는 디렉토리 (= 샌드박스) HEAD와 Index는 .git 디렉토리에 저장되고, 워킹 디렉토리는 실제 파일로 존재한다. 2. Staging Area 또는 Index : 작업 디렉토리에 있는 변경 사항들 중에서 다음 커밋에 포함될 변경 사항들을 선택하는 중간 단계 스테이징 영역에 추가되면 다음 커밋에 포함된 내용이 준비됨. 3. Repository(∋ HEAD) : Git의 핵심적인 데이터베이스로, 모든 커밋 이력과 버전 관리 정보가 저장되는 곳. 여기서 HEAD는 현재 작업 중인 브랜.. 2023. 8. 23.
GitHub 사용법 4편 : CLI 명령어 [CLI의 개념] CLI 란? Command Line Interface의 약자로, 컴퓨터 터미널 또는 명령 프롬포트를 통해 텍스트 기반으로 조작할 수 있도록 하는 명령어들의 집합이다. CLI를 사용하면 파일 조작, 시스템 설정, 프로그램 실행 등 다양한 작업을 수행할 수 있고, CLI 명령어는 주로 터미널 창에서 입력하며 컴퓨터와 상호작용하는 방법 중의 하나이다. [명령어 종류] 기본적인 Unix/Linux 명령어 명령어 의미 설명 $ sudo super user do 1. 관리자만 읽을 수 있는 파일 읽기 2. 새로운 프로그램 설치(Ubuntu Linus) 3. Notes : 새로운 프로그램 설치 시, Package Manager를 이용하는 것이 보편적 $ ls list 파일 보기 $ al all 파일.. 2023. 8. 23.